LONDON (Brand Republic) - The government’s Home Office has almost doubled its advertising spend in 2000 compared with last year.
In answer to a written question in the House of Commons yesterday, home secretary Jack Straw said that Home Office adspend was 11.08m so far this year. Last year, it was 5.65m ...

LONDON (Brand Republic) UK mobile phone group Vodafone has agreed to buy Eircell - the Irish mobile phone business owned by Ireland s national telecoms company, Eircom - in a deal worth 2.6bn. The purchase, which is understood to be the biggest Irish corporate takeover to date, cannot be completed until ...

LONDON (Brand Republic) – Current Wimbledon and US Open champion Venus Williams has signed what is reportedly a 27m endorsement deal with sportswear manufacturer Reebok, a record figure for a female athlete.
The tennis player has represented the sports apparel brand in TV and print campaigns since 1995. The current ...

LONDON (Brand Republic) - Sir Richard Branson’s Virgin Rail Group has failed in its bid to take over the east coast mainline between London and Edinburgh.
The Shadow Strategic Rail Authority awarded the rail franchise to the line’s current operator, Great North Eastern Railway. Virgin Rail, which ...
